B3 Lab Undergraduate Research Program
The B3 Lab supports a large, undergraduate research program in animal science, neuroendocrinology, and reproductive behavior. Students intern for a minimum of one year for 10hr/week or more, mentored by our graduate students, lab manager, and postdocs in collaboration with Dr. Calisi. Most students begin by assisting with the research of our dove colony. First, they are trained in animal husbandry, health checks, and how to observe and document animal behavior data. As these skills become mastered, there is room for growth within the lab assisting in specific projects, assays, techniques, field collections, data analyses, and manuscript write-up in significant ways and potentially conducting a senior thesis. Undergraduate student alumni have continued on to competitive PhD Programs, including Columbia University (Sana Chintamin and Steffani Siller), UC Davis (Lea Pollack), UC Riverside (Catherine Nguyen), and Masters programs, including San Francisco State University (Hanna Butler-Struben). Our undergraduates have also been accepted to MD and DVM programs, including Stanford University School of Medicine (Nelson Amorín), State University of New York (SUNY) Downstate College of Medicine (Jessamine Fazli), and Cornell College of Veterinary Medicine (Yanick Couture). We also encourage the pursuit of other STEM careers, and many of our undergraduates are interested in pursuing careers in science education and communication, so look out for them!

Article about Undergraduate Research in the B3 Lab
by UC Davis Science Writer Greg Watry
A hallmark of the UC Davis undergraduate experience is working alongside graduate students and faculty to conduct scientific research. But too often, undergraduates must make a difficult choice between accepting an unpaid internship or finding a part-time job unrelated to their academic interests.
To encourage students to gain hands-on experience, Assistant Professor Rebecca M. Calisi, Department of Neurobiology, Physiology and Behavior in the College of Biological Sciences, launched the Calisi Lab Undergraduate Research Program.. (see more)

Papers with Undergraduate Authors
* denotes undergraduate author
- Ondrasek, N.R., Freeman, S.M., Saldana, E., Orellana Bonilla, I., Bales, K.L. and Calisi, R.M. 2018. Nonapeptide receptor distributions in promising avian models for social neuroecology. Frontiers in Ecology and Evolution. (in press).
- Calisi, R.M., Chintamen, S.*, Ennin, E.*, Kriegsfeld, L.J., Rosenblum, E.B. 2017. Neuroanatomical evolution in response to a changing environment. Journal of Herpetology. 51:258-262. (pdf)
- Pollack, L.*, Ondrasek, N., Calisi, R.M. 2017. Urban health and ecology: the promise of an avian biomonitoring tool. Current Zoology. 63:205-212. (pdf)
- Calisi, R.M., Geraghty, A., Avila, A.*, Kaufer, D., Bentley, G.E., Wingfield, JC. 2016. Patterns of hypothalamic GnIH change over the reproductive period in starlings and rats. General and Comparative Endocrinology, 237: 140-146. (pdf)
- Cai, F.* and Calisi, R.M. 2016. Seasons and neighborhoods of high lead toxicity in New York City: the feral pigeon as a bioindicator. Chemosphere, 161: 274-279. (pdf)
- Amorín, N.* and Calisi, R.M. 2015. Measurements of Neuronal Soma Size and Estimated Peptide Concentrations in Addition to Cell Abundance Offer a Higher Resolution of Seasonal and Reproductive Influences of GnRH-I and GnIH in European Starlings. Journal of Integrative and Comparative Biology. (pdf)
- Calisi, R.M., Rizzo, N.O.*, Bentley, G.E. 2008. Seasonal differences in hypothalamic EGR-1 and GnIH expression following capturehandling stress in house sparrows (Passer domesticus). General and Comparative Endocrinology, 157(3): 283-287. (pdf)
